    RPhil's Excursion

    On the 5.4L motors, the key to tightening the spark plugs is to slightly "over-tighten" them. Not sure if it's the same for the V10s. The factory torque spec isn't good enough. Good luck getting that one bolt out.

  14. E

    2000 Ford Explorer

    If you're going to spend the time and effort to do it, don't go with the factory LS. Get an ARB locker or Truetrac LSD or something. You've got only 30s on there now. 33x12.5 will fit with a 3" body lift without touching the torsion bars (and maybe some light trimming). I didn't like the...
